Mechanism of deflagration-to-detonation transition in gas
Abstract
The deflagration-to-detonation transition on the tip of an elongated flame in a tube is shown to be related to a dynamical saddle-node bifurcation of the inner flame structure leading to a runaway of the pressure in finite time. The comparison with the experiments shows a good agreement.
